Northam – National Union of Mineworkers chief negotiator, Ecliff Tantsi, on Wednesday this week was confident that it was only a matter of time before NUM and Northam Platinum settled their differences over wage negotiations which caused the prolonged strike at the Zondereinde mine in Limpopo. At present the strike will continue after NUM rejected Northam’s revised wage offer. Northam spokesperson, Marion Brower said, “We hope that some kind of settlement can be reached, expeditiously. [Because the] company is suffering, employees are

suffering and we have to reach a settlement which both parties will be party to.”The latest offer on the table is 9.5%, while NUM demanded 16% as well as a 69% in-crease in living-out allowances. NUM also indicated its willingness to enter into a two-year wage deal, as long as half of the wage increases (still to be agreed upon) occurred in the first year, whereas Northam wants a three-year deal. Currently the only major platinum producer where NUM is still the leading trade union and the fourth-largest producer, Northam

has lost R500 million in revenue and the workers have lost R100 million in wages. Nearly a quarter of the year’s production re-mains unmined and apart from the severe financial repercussions, there is the possibil-ity that workers will be laid off once the strike comes to an end.All eyes are on the outcome of the latest meeting, as senior executives and analysts agree the industry cannot afford double-digit increases. At this stage it seems that AMCU, who re-ceived the mandate to strike at the three

biggest platinum producers, Anglo American Platinum, Impala Platinum and Lonmin, is holding off on work stoppages in anticipa-tion of a resolution to the Northam strike. If NUM is successful, AMCU will undoubtedly demand more. If NUM accedes, AMCU has the choice of trying to get a better deal, or call an all-out strike after giving the required 48-hour no-tice to management.Should AMCU succeed in getting a better wage hike with a shorter strike, chances are NUM will lose more members to AMCU.
